Best Applications for This Grade
- Commonly applied in environmental engineering and municipal wastewater treatment facilities to directly oxidize complex organic compounds, lower total biochemical oxygen demand, and effectively mitigate heavy hydrogen sulfide odors within flowing effluent streams.
- Commonly applied in the commercial pulp and paper manufacturing sector as a reliable elemental chlorine-free bleaching agent, breaking down tough lignin structures to significantly improve final paper brightness without generating unwanted chlorinated chemical byproducts.
- Relied upon by commercial textile mills during the initial fabric preparation phase to efficiently bleach raw natural and synthetic fibers, establishing a consistent, uniform color baseline required before initiating complex, large-scale dyeing processes.
- Functions as a primary oxidizing agent in heavy chemical synthesis, reacting readily under controlled conditions to facilitate the industrial production of epoxides, organic peroxides, and various other intermediary chemical compounds necessary for advanced manufacturing.
- Commonly applied in specific mining and metal processing operations to optimize the extraction of target metals from raw excavated ores, leveraging its strong liquid oxidizing properties to improve overall material yield and daily operational efficiency.
